Seal sang in the name of love and joy on Aug. 31 at Hudson Yards.
The Grammy-winning artist joined world-renowned contemporary artist Brendan Murphy for day that was dedicated to the on-going incredible efforts of The Person First organization.
Alongside Murphy’s striking 12-foot LOVE MATTERS…Everywhere: The Loehr Bear – which was dedicated to The Person First, a nonprofit focused on youth mental health, resilience and helping young people develop the tools to thrive – Seal sang his heart out to a captivated audience at the landmark outdoor space.

Together in unison with the crowd singing along, a beautiful tribute was made to Dr. Loehr by Seal, an active board member of The Person First. The serenade of “Stand By Me” in front of the larger-than-life bear made the audience blissfully teary eyed when they understood the powerful impact of the day.
The special gathering honored the late renowned performance psychologist Dr. Jim Loehr, who co-founded The Person First with Gordon Uehling III and whose life was dedicated to making the world a better place for all.

Gordon was joined by his daughter Zia Victoria and her husband Jonah Marais. Zia and Jonah are both solo artists and mentees of Dr. Loehr. Also in attendance was Murphy, whose LOVE MATTERS…Everywhere: The Loehr Bear serves as a larger-than-life reminder of the message at the heart of the moment.
